PKGBUILD.5: document that the pkgver() function runs after prepare()

Signed-off-by: Allan McRae <allan@archlinux.org>
This commit is contained in:
Allan McRae 2016-03-28 16:24:22 +10:00
parent 2ee1706a72
commit 5901038610

View file

@ -52,10 +52,10 @@ similar to `$_basekernver`.
+ +
The `pkgver` variable can be automatically updated by providing a `pkgver()` The `pkgver` variable can be automatically updated by providing a `pkgver()`
function in the PKGBUILD that outputs the new package version. function in the PKGBUILD that outputs the new package version.
This is run after downloading and extracting the sources so it can use those This is run after downloading and extracting the sources and running the
files in determining the new `pkgver`. `prepare()` function (if present), so it can use those files in determining the
This is most useful when used with sources from version control systems (see new `pkgver`. This is most useful when used with sources from version control
below). systems (see below).
*pkgrel*:: *pkgrel*::
This is the release number specific to the Arch Linux release. This This is the release number specific to the Arch Linux release. This